Transaction ae1446c7aa0dfc6e3e0427f1f3549451889441ec1efaffa16ef97f9356424ea2

block
228ae71074c6e6850a8c2356d133b46fe445d86f7b8135e261a740c337b9d0cd

1 Input

23 Outputs